Jack Cross - Most Underrated
Roger Murdock/Mazatt
![]() It's not always easy getting the short stick of incredible positional depth on a team, but its harder to react well to it. In this case, Roger Murdock (Mazatt) has played a pivotal role in mentoring rookies over the past seasons while Betzee Nickelback and Dag-Otto Bjorntjanst were given priority as the 1C and 2C for the squids. This meant Roger was centering a third line which saw a fair amount of rotation in its wingers, from rookies Cob (now entering his 4th season) at one point to fresh out of the minor leagues Peppi Guiseppe and Lukas Fischer. Murdock has provided much needed stability in an otherwise inexperienced third unit, even going as far as playing a handful of games as a defensemen when called upon. In the end, it's a respectable 17 goals and 24 assists for 41 points, not the flashiest, but given the circumstances in which they were had, it's more than stellar work.
The theme of Murdock's season has been ''answering the call'', and he's done it brilliantly, never complained, kept his head down and gave everything on every shift, and this resulted in two monster rookie seasons from both Guiseppe and Fischer who respectively finished with 49 and 45 points. They deserve a lot of credit, but this is enabled by the big man in the middle, Roger Murdock, and this selflessness and team play is extremely deserving of a Jack Cross nomination, but more than that is what characterizes a winner.

Abdi Smokes / locrianmidwest
![]() On a team loaded top to bottom with talent, even a player with a capped build can struggle to stand out, and even moreso when that player is a true defensive defenseman more concerned with shutting down the opposition than putting pucks in the net. While they may be low on QCC's point totals, Abdi Smokes has been a stalwart blue line defender since they joined a scrappy young team off the waiver wire back in S73.
This year in particular, Smokes was a key part of QCC's shutdown line, matched up against the opposing team's top scorers with the express goal of making sure nothing productive happened on the ice. In spite of that tough assignment, Abdi generated opportunities up and down the ice, ending up 10th in the league in +/- and 31st in CF%. Adjusting for matchups, this meant the team could safely throw them out against the league's best and turn what should be damage control into reliable scoring chances for the rest of the line. The top scorers will rightfully get most of the attention, but QCC would not have won the regular season title or posted the highest goal differential of any team since S68 without having a game changer on the blue line in key moments.
Abdi's presence off the ice can't be understated either. A team with high expectations can be as stressful as it is fun, and the team needed a reliable lighthearted presence to keep us in check and focused on the most important thing: spending time together and enjoying every step of the journey. From memes to music and the occasional bit of mayhem, they were there every step of the way to make this season one to remember for a lifetime.
